Why You Should Have Patio Enclosures In Your Abode

If you enjoy staying at your patio, but don't enjoy the creepy-crawly and mosquitoes that fly around, then you must confine your patio with patio enclosures or insect screen.
With patio enclosures, you don't have to be anxious about the pests and mosquitoes anymore, and you can stay in your patio all you want.
It will make your residence more valuable and serviceable.
It can be a corner for relaxation, eating or entertaining.
You can either acquire ready-made enclosure kits or fit a custom-built patio enclosure or insect screen.
Whether you'll choose the former or the latter, you'll still have your own enclosures.
Don't forget to acquire a building permit when you'll be constructing your patio enclosures.
You have to take right dimensions of the area where the future insect screen or patio enclosures will be set.
So that you'll not forget anything, itemize everything you need for the building.
You'll need support beams to hold your patio enclosures, or else you have to build them before constructing the actual enclosures.
Paint the support beams and the bottom of the roof of your patio; it is presupposed that you only have to add the enclosures to the existing roof and patio floor.
The supports and the roofing are now prepared.
Let's move on to the insect screen or patio enclosures themselves.
Would you fabricate permanent or removable enclosures? If you want removable enclosures, select those that are fastened with Velcro.
There is also an insect screen that you could just push back if you don't want it to be totally taken off.
For permanent protection, there are big wooden or aluminum framed insect screen panels that are easy to set up.
This requires dedicated equipment and more difficult carpentry abilities.
Ready-made screen door panels are offered for those who want to do less difficult carpentry; you'll just have to attach them to the support beams with wood screws using hinges and handles.
You now have your own enclosures.
If you paint the ceiling of your patio, and fix lights and fans, you could even make your patio look even better.
Don't let the rain get inside your patio by spread outing the roofing beyond 15 to 20 inches from the insect screen.
